You'll usually find 0 trains per day running between Marks Tey and Waltham Cross, which usually take 1 hour 30 minutes to complete the 37 miles (60 km) journey. It can take as little as 1 hour 26 minutes on the fastest services though, if you want to get there as quickly as possible. Although there aren't any direct services on this line, it's still easy to travel to Waltham Cross by train, you'll just need to make 1 change along the way. Greater Anglia trains are the main operator of services on this route, so you're likely to travel with them for all or at least part of your journey to Waltham Cross.
